FTBFS due to use of %{_target_platform}, use %{_vpath_builddir} instead

2021-07-30 Thread Eike Rathke
Hi, It just hit me and I didn't find it on this list, so.. In spec after %cmake_install a cd %{_target_platform} failed for the rawhide mass rebuild with no such directory. After being pointed out (thanks Neal) to change that to cd %{_vpath_builddir} it works. Reason:
